Galaxy S21 FE has a score of 89.1, which is much better than Samsung Galaxy A9 Pro (2016)'s overall score of 74.4. The Galaxy S21 FE is a somewhat lighter cellphone than the Samsung Galaxy A9 Pro (2016), but they have the same thickness. Both phones we are comparing include Android OS (operating system), but the Galaxy S21 FE has the previous 11 version and Samsung Galaxy A9 Pro (2016) has Android 8.0 Oreo.
Galaxy S21 FE features a little bit better processing power than Galaxy A9 Pro (2016), and although they both have a Octa-Core CPU, the Galaxy S21 FE also has a higher amount of RAM. Galaxy S21 FE has a little bit better screen than Galaxy A9 Pro (2016), because it has a quite higher pixel density, a little bit higher resolution of 1080 x 2340 and a little bit larger display.
Samsung Galaxy S21 FE features a quite bigger storage to install applications and games than Samsung Galaxy A9 Pro (2016), because although it has no external memory slot, it also counts with more internal memory. The Galaxy S21 FE counts with a lot better camera than Samsung Galaxy A9 Pro (2016), because although it has a back-facing camera with a way lower resolution, it also counts with a larger aperture to capture better captures and videos in low light situations.
Galaxy A9 Pro (2016) features a bit longer battery performance than Samsung Galaxy S21 FE, because it has a 5000mAh battery capacity.
